The `lexi-harvest` script scans the Brindlewick web client for tagged strings and writes candidate entries to the localization staging tables. Before running it, confirm no extraction job is already active by checking `harvest.lock` in the repo root; concurrent runs will duplicate keys. Execute `python lexi_harvest.py --locale-set full`, which takes roughly six minutes. Review the diff summary it prints before approving the upload step. The script connects to the staging database using the credentials that follow below.

primary connection of kahof-kagep = mssql://belath_svc:3uqY4g6LHG5Nyi@db-d0ba.ferralabs.corp:5432/rusdor

Management Meeting Minutes — Reseller Programme

Attendees: sales leads plus Dana from ops.

Quick recap: partner count up to nine, Fellhurst Supply smashing targets, Oakmere lagging. Agreed to trim the bronze tier and push co-marketing funds toward Q4. Training refresh lands next month. One sensitive item on future plans is noted confidentially below.

confidential, bahof-yaweg: Headcount on the Kaseth team goes from 32 to 109 by the end of January. Gross margin on Kaseth came in at 46 percent against a plan of 45 percent.

**Vendor note: checkout load testing**

We contract Bramblegate Labs for quarterly load tests of the Tillford checkout flow. Scope covers cart, payment, and confirmation endpoints up to 5x peak traffic. Results land in the shared test archive within ten days. Maintainers renewing the contract or scheduling runs should contact the vendor liaison here.

escalation mailbox, bafog-fafog: ulador@paliqlabs.internal